Graveside services for Dessie Corine Harrison, age 98, will be held at 11:00 A.M. Friday, February 26, 2021 in Dublin Memorial Gardens with Bishop Cory Danner officiating.
Dessie Corine Cooper Harrison (Mama Rene) was born in Empire, Dodge County, Georgia on December 7, 1922 to Ray Pierce Cooper and Estelle Mullis. Corine was the third of seven children. Siblings in birth order were Jewell Barton, Hazel, Ray Pierce Jr, Ivelyn, William Bradley, and Dolly Jo. She is survived by her brother William Bradley Cooper (Joan) of Augusta, GA. Corine was living in Chester, GA when she met and married Bennie Ashley Harrison of Montrose, GA. They lived many years on their farm outside of Dudley, GA, later they moved with their youngest son to 202 Mecca Street, Dublin GA. They had four children--Bennie Ashley Harrison Jr. who passed away at one year of age, Dessie Yvonne (Otis Lord), Linda Sylvine (Schuyler Seeley), and Larry Edward (Susan Peters). She was blessed with 12 grandchildren; David Lord (Nancy), Tami Upshaw (Jody), Kevin Seeley (Cathy), Linda Baranowski (Bryan), Brent Seeley (Fiona), Lisa Gardner, Larry Seeley (Andrea), Ryan Seeley (Jenissa), Angie Ford (Chris), Larry Jr (Mary), Lindsay Boys (Ryan), and Matthew Harrison. She also had 41 great grandchildren, and 3 great-great grandchildren. Corine worked many years as an Inventory Management Specialist at Robins Airforce Base in Warner Robins, GA. She was preceded in death by her husband in 1993, and children Bennie Ashley Jr. and Dessie Yvonne Lord. After her retirement, she volunteered service as a Pink Lady at Fairview Park Hospital. She loved being outside working in her yard caring for her daylilies and hydrangeas. Mama Rene loved her family dearly and enjoyed spending time talking about her life and sharing stories of her childhood. She was a member of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ints. She returned to her Father in Heaven and other members of her family on 23 February 2021.
